Sometimes when using ListX (1.9), the query can take a while to pull data (especially if connecting to remote data stores). It would be nice if there was a "Loading...." message displayed on the screen while the data was loading.

I realize that this could probably be done with some javascript and event handling... but i thought it would be nice if Bi4ce could add this in to happen automatically??

It already does show a "Fetching Data..." message - just make sure that Custom Status is unchecked.
